As summer approaches, families are actively planning to balance fun, enrichment, and continued learning for their children. The search for the right summer camp experience is in full swing, with options ranging from traditional outdoor adventures to specialized programs focusing on STEM, arts, and athletics. These camps are widely recognized as vital for promoting social skills, independence, and a break from routine screen time.
Concurrently, parents are increasingly seeking educational resources and school-related programs to support their children's academic journey year-round. This includes exploring tutoring services, enrichment workshops, and strategies to combat summer learning loss. The focus is on creating a holistic approach where recreational summer experiences complement educational goals.
Experts suggest that the most successful plans often involve children in the decision-making process, ensuring the selected activities align with their interests and needs. The current landscape offers diverse opportunities for every family, aiming to create a summer that is both memorable and constructive, fostering growth in a variety of settings outside the traditional classroom.
